How they compare

Croatia currently reports 640,942 kg against 578,694 kg in Philippines, a difference of 62,248 kg.

That makes Croatia's figure about 1.1 times Philippines's.

Across all 32 years both countries report, Croatia has been ahead every year.

Croatia ranks 42nd and Philippines ranks 44th of 93 countries.

Croatia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Croatia Philippines Difference Ahead
1990s 1.31 million kg 455,684 kg 852,903 kg Croatia
2000s 978,289 kg 543,136 kg 435,153 kg Croatia
2010s 910,784 kg 572,220 kg 338,564 kg Croatia
2020s 765,270 kg 578,943 kg 186,327 kg Croatia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
